Property Description for 64-33 99th Street, 6-L

Make this oversized Junior 4 co-op your own! Spacious layout and potential 2 bedroom apartment. Located in a classic pre-war well-maintained building with elevator, laundry on premises and a live-in super. Maintenance includes everything except electricity. Storage available for bikes. Conveniently located steps away from all shopping & transportation.

Rego Park | Queens

Quick Profile

Founded in the 1920s by the Real Good Construction Company—hence “Rego”—the neighborhood grew as a suburban-style enclave of single-family homes before giving way to large apartment complexes after World War II. Rego Park today is a blend of mid-century high-rises, garden apartments, and commercial corridors. Its population is diverse, with Jewish, Russian, Bukharian, and Central Asian communities shaping the area’s cultural fabric. Known for its shopping hubs and easy access to Manhattan via subway, Rego Park strikes a balance between quiet residential life and urban convenience.
